Eco-Panda to exhibit at Go Green Expo

Eco-Panda, the world’s only recycled nylon swimwear line, will be exhibiting at the Go Green Expo in Los Angeles, CA, January 22nd-24th, 2010 with their exhibit booth hosted by Bianca Peters, the reigning Miss Malibu.

Visitors to the Eco-Panda booth will experience the ultimate in modern fashion including the unveiling of the 2010 swim wear line with a mini fashion show, hourly product give-a-way’s and a behind the scenes look at the technological advances behind the production of the brand. Eco-Panda will also be offering exclusive steals & deals on their 2009 swimwear to all Go Green Expo attendees.

Eco-Panda splashed on the scene of the swimwear industry in June of 2009. Debuting their eclectic line of swimwear featuring vibrant colors & bold hues, Eco-Panda drew inspiration from fashion mecca’s of the world including: Tokyo, Cozumel, Morocco, and Paris. The Eco-Panda brand has proven that eco-fashion doesn’t have to lack style or quality. No attention to detail has been spared with this impeccable line of eco-swimwear, including the fact that each garment lasts up to three times as long as the average swimsuit due to the unique blend of MIPAN regen.

Waves of Change…Eco-Panda swimwear is composed of MIPAN regen recycled nylon, which is created from post-consumer fishing nets. The recycled fishing nets are ground into fabric chips, which are then liquefied, creating fiber, which in turn is spun into fabric.

Recycled Swimwear Line By Eco-Panda

Eco-Panda has splashed onto the apparel scene with its revolutionary line of eco-chic swimwear. Its fresh collection combines high-fashion with eco-friendly components, making it one of the first eco-swimwear lines to appear in the swimwear market and industry. Eco-Panda swimwear is comprised of recycled nylon and Xtra Life Lycra, creating a garment that lasts three times longer than the average swimsuit.

By using recycled nylon, Eco-Panda helps sustain the environment for future generations by diminishing greenhouse gas emissions that lead to global warming, minimizing the use of landfill sites and incineration, and it helps prevent exhaustion of our limited natural petroleum resources. In fact, recycled nylon uses 27% less natural petroleum resources, and emits 28% less greenhouse gases. Eco-Panda holds the exclusive rights to recycled nylon here is the US, making it a tough act for any competitor to follow.


The summer 2009 Collection boasts fierce prints and electric hues complete with essentials including cover-ups and totes. The collection draws on global inspiration, with design collections such as “Montego Bay”, “Tokyo Station”, “Marrakech”, and “Jungle Beat”. Each collection is a limited edition, without plans for re-production when the collections sell through. New styles will be released monthly, including a couture line available early June. Eco-Panda believes that ecoapparel can be both fashion-forward and affordable, making the best of both worlds’ reality for today’s consumer.
